2026 RAM PROMASTER BEV Recall: What To Do

Recall Summary

Recall number 26V531000
Issued by National Highway Traffic Safety Administration
Date 2026-08-13
Company Chrysler (FCA US, LLC)
Units affected 844,027
Severity Not classified

Remedy: Radio software will be updated by a dealer or through an over-the-air (OTA) update, free of charge. Owner notification letters are expected to be mailed beginning September 1, 2026. Owners may contact Chrysler customer service at 800-853-1403. Chrysler’s number for this recall is 78D. Vehicle Identification Numbers (VINs) involved in this recall will be searchable on NHTSA.gov on August 20, 2026.

Read the official National Highway Traffic Safety Administration recall notice

The chrysler fca recall announced in August 2026 affects the 2026 RAM ProMaster BEV. Chrysler (FCA US, LLC) filed the action with the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ration. The agency logged it as recall number 26V531000 on August 13, 2026. The problem involves a rearview camera image that may fail to display. That blind spot behind the vehicle raises crash risk during backing. The scope covers 844,027 units. If you own or drive one of these vans, this guide explains what happened and what to do next.

What the Chrysler Fca Recall Covers

The recalled product is the 2026 RAM ProMaster BEV. This is Chrysler’s battery-electric commercial cargo van. NHTSA lists 844,027 units within the scope of this chrysler fca recall. That is a large population by any standard. Commercial fleets, delivery operators, and independent owners are all potentially affected.

Chrysler assigned its own internal number to the action: 78D. NHTSA assigned 26V531000. Both numbers refer to the same chrysler fca recall. Keep both handy when you call a dealer. Service departments often search by one or the other.

Vehicle Identification Numbers involved became searchable on NHTSA.gov on August 20, 2026. That is the fastest way to confirm your specific van. A model year match alone does not confirm inclusion. Recall populations are usually defined by build date ranges and component supply. As a result, two identical-looking vans may have different recall status.

Owner notification letters are expected to be mailed beginning September 1, 2026. However, you do not need to wait for a letter. The VIN lookup tool is live now. For example, a fleet manager can run a batch of VINs today rather than waiting on mail. That saves weeks of exposure.

The Hazard and Reported Injuries

The hazard in this chrysler fca recall is straightforward. The rearview camera image may fail to display. When the screen stays blank or freezes, the driver loses the view behind the vehicle. NHTSA states plainly that this increases the risk of a crash.

Backup cameras are not a convenience feature. Federal rules require rear visibility systems on new light vehicles. The requirement exists because backover crashes are hard to prevent by mirrors alone. Cargo vans are especially affected. The ProMaster has no rear window in many configurations, so the camera is often the only rearward view.

The agency record does not state whether any injuries have been reported in connection with this chrysler fca recall. We will not claim that injuries occurred, and we will not claim that none did. NHTSA also did not assign a severity classification to this action. That absence is a data gap, not a safety verdict.

Typically, camera display failures are intermittent. The screen may work on one start and fail on the next. In most cases, that inconsistency is what makes the defect dangerous. A driver who trusts the system may back up before noticing the image never appeared.

What To Do If You Own This Product

Start by confirming your vehicle is included. Find your 17-character VIN on the driver-side dashboard or door jamb. Then enter it at the official NHTSA recall notice for 26V531000. The lookup went live on August 20, 2026.

The remedy is a radio software update. A dealer can perform it, or it may arrive as an over-the-air (OTA) update. Either path is free of charge. Federal law prohibits manufacturers from charging owners for a safety recall repair on a vehicle of this age.

If your van supports OTA delivery, keep it connected and powered when prompted. However, do not assume the update installed silently. Confirm it. A dealer can verify the software level and close out the chrysler fca recall in Chrysler’s system.

Until the fix is applied, drive defensively in reverse. Use your mirrors. Walk behind the vehicle before backing in tight areas. Ask a spotter to guide you when possible. For example, delivery drivers backing into loading docks should treat the camera as unavailable until repaired. Chrysler customer service is reachable at 800-853-1403. Reference recall 78D or 26V531000.

Does a Chrysler Fca Recall Mean You Can Sue?

No. A recall is not a lawsuit. A chrysler fca recall is a safety action taken under federal motor vehicle safety law. It is a repair program, not a finding of liability and not a compensation fund. Many recalls are completed without a single legal claim ever being filed.

A recall alone is not a legal claim. To have a potential case, a person generally needs an actual injury or loss, and a causal link between the defect and that harm. Lawyers call that causation. Without it, there is typically no claim to bring, no matter how serious the defect sounds.

We are not aware of, and are not asserting, any lawsuit over this specific chrysler fca recall. Nothing in the agency record establishes one. However, if you were involved in a backing crash and believe the camera failed, you may be eligible to pursue a claim. That depends entirely on your facts.

Talk to a licensed attorney in your state before drawing conclusions. Deadlines called statutes of limitations apply, and they vary. In most cases, preserving evidence matters enormously. Keep the vehicle, photos, repair orders, dashcam footage, and any police report. No outcome is ever guaranteed.

How Recalls Connect to Mass Tort Cases

Recalls and mass torts are separate, but they sometimes intersect. A recall notice documents that a manufacturer identified a defect, described the risk, and offered a remedy. As a result, plaintiffs’ lawyers often use recall records as evidence of notice and knowledge. The recall itself does not prove liability. It simply creates a dated, official paper trail.

History shows the pattern. Takata airbag inflators were recalled across tens of millions of vehicles, and years of consolidated litigation followed for people who alleged injuries from ruptures. The Philips CPAP foam recall in 2021 was followed by multidistrict litigation brought by users who claimed harm.

In both examples, the recall came first and the litigation grew from injury claims layered on top of it. Typically, most recalls never follow that path at all. The vast majority end quietly with a free repair, which is the outcome NHTSA and manufacturers want.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is the repair for this recall free?

Yes. Chrysler will update the radio software at no charge, either through a dealer or over the air. You should not be billed for the recall remedy. If a dealer tries to charge you, contact Chrysler at 800-853-1403.

Can I still drive my RAM ProMaster BEV?

The agency notice does not tell owners to stop driving. However, the rearview camera may not display, so back up with extra caution. Use mirrors, check behind the vehicle first, and use a spotter when available.

How do I know if my van is included?

Enter your VIN in the NHTSA recall lookup, which has covered this recall since August 20, 2026. You can also call Chrysler and reference recall 78D or NHTSA number 26V531000. Owner letters begin mailing September 1, 2026.
